Overview: The recent Hackensack City Council meeting was dominated by discussions on the Hackensack Comprehensive Bicycle Plan and various community issues. The bicycle plan, a key project funded by the New Jersey Department of Transportation (NJ DOT), aims to improve safety and infrastructure for cyclists across Hackensack. The council also heard from residents on issues ranging from parking and rooming houses to public school conditions and the need for a dog park.

Overview: The Hillsborough County School Board meeting focused on discussions regarding the removal of certain books from school libraries and the approval of budgetary allocations. The board voted unanimously to remove specific books from school libraries following the Superintendent’s recommendation, despite voiced concerns over state pressure and legal threats. Additionally, the board approved fiscal plans for the upcoming year, including salary adjustments and a budget meant to address the district’s varied needs.

Overview: During the recent Fort Worth City Council meeting, attention was directed towards proposed zoning changes on Panther Island aimed at stimulating development. The council aims to attract development partners through these changes.

Overview: The Revere School Committee meeting on September 9th focused on declining student enrollment, technology resource challenges, and various funding initiatives. Discussion covered topics including a decrease in enrollment below 7,000 students, technology resource management, and new grant-funded educational programs.

Overview: At a recent Traverse City Area School Board meeting, members engaged in discussions about the implications of potential changes in state education funding, the strategic plan for 2025 to 2030, and the allocation of resources for special education and literacy initiatives.
